    Stepping into SaS General Store feels like walking onto the set of an old movie. If you've ever…read morewondered what shopping might have been like decades ago, this is a fun place to experience a little bit of that nostalgia. I stopped by on a Sunday afternoon, and there was plenty of parking in the large lot. It wasn't too crowded, which made it easy to take my time exploring. One of the first things I noticed was all the classic cars parked outside from different eras--they definitely added to the vintage atmosphere. Inside, the store has several sections featuring SAS shoes, along with a small old-fashioned snack counter offering popcorn, candy, and sodas. The prices were a fun surprise--popcorn was just 25¢, and I believe the soda was only 5¢. In today's world where everything seems to cost more every week, it was a nice little throwback. Beyond the shopping, I enjoyed looking at all the vintage appliances and memorabilia throughout the store. It was interesting to see how much things have changed over the years and appreciate how far we've come. The staff was friendly, and there were plenty of shoe sales happening during my visit. Whether you're shopping for comfortable shoes, love vintage memorabilia, or just want to spend a little time somewhere unique, SaS General Store is a charming stop that's worth checking out.

    4 stars, cause I wish it were a bit lower price....but I bought a beautiful short sleeved casual…read moresweater with Swarvoski swirls, and silver swirls on it. The shirt's design is guaranteed for life. If one falls off, you send in the shirt and they replace the lost crystal for free. I was impressed with this little shop. It's nice finding a boutique with clothes that fit all sizes. Most things they carry have Swarvoski crystals on it. I found a pair of yoga pants for $320.00 with Swarvoski crystals around the band on on the leg, and t-shirts around 50.00. The tshirts are high quality shirt that can easily be worn as sweaters, for the most part. Tank tops with crystals worn casually or under jackets. They have jackets that are crazy high dollar as well. Purses and belts, that I didn't check the price. The owners are really nice and helpful. There is a large dressing room. I tried on a tunic sweater with crystals I almost bought. The clothing is well made. The sweater I bough has crystals at the neckline and also on the sleeves. It is work wearable (I dress up for work, but not too dressy), or it can be worn with jeans. It is made by Christine Alexander. They have belts by Tony Rama. They carry shoes that I didn't get the designer's name. They have so much more in their store than on the website. Very happy with this little store. When I come back through, I'll be checking in there to see what else they have. I've said it thousands of times. Why by a knock off when you can buy the real thing? I went into the next store and saw them ironing on crystal like transfers. I'd rather pass on that. Silver Spur has the real thing, and the guarantee to go along with it. Why buy less quality?
